Meaning of "your household waste"

The phrase 'your household waste' refers to the garbage or trash that is generated from everyday activities in a household. It includes items such as food scraps, packaging materials, and other discarded items. This phrase is used to indicate the waste produced within one's home that needs to be properly disposed of
